A cavernous-but-packed restaurant in the heart of the diverse and affluent South Side neighborhood of Hyde Park, Medici on 57th is wildly popular with University of Chicago students -- especially when their parents are visiting. Even if you aren't from Hyde Park, this is the type of place where you are likely to run into at least one person you know. The high ceilings and cheerful Italian decor give the place a nice setting, though the atmosphere remains a bit loud for in- depth conversations. The food runs the gamut from American to Italian to Mexican, with hearty breakfasts that always seem to ease the effects of a hard night of partying. There's even a selection of quality veggie burgers and tofu entrees for the vegetarians. -- Kari Lydersen
